Otter Spirit Animal

The Otter is a friendly rebel, playful in company and drawn to ideas no one else has considered yet.

inventiveunconventionalplayfulfree-spirited

Meaning

The Otter archetype pairs curiosity with an independent streak. Where other people see a fixed rule, you often see a starting point that can be tested, improved or made more playful. People may notice your easy warmth before they notice how unconventional your thinking can be. This reading points toward wide interests, varied friendships and a need for room to experiment. Its useful question is whether freedom is helping you explore with purpose or simply keeping every commitment at a distance.

Strengths

You are genuinely inventive, sociable, and impossible to box in. You read people quickly and disarm them with humor, which lets you slip past defenses that block more forceful types. Crises rarely rattle you because your brain treats a problem as a puzzle, not a threat, and you can improvise a workaround while everyone else is still panicking. At your best you are the friend who makes the impossible feel like a fun experiment.

Challenges

That same restlessness can scatter you. You start ten things and finish three, and your need for independence can read as aloofness to people who wanted commitment, not cleverness. When you feel cornered or misunderstood you can turn provocative on purpose, picking the contrarian side just to keep your freedom. The Otter grows by learning that following through on one idea is not the same as a cage.
